NWFL Premiership Second Stanza Returns with High Stakes as Super Six Race and Relegation Battle Intensify

The Nigeria Women Football League (NWFL) Premiership resumes this midweek with nine crucial fixtures as the second stanza begins across the country. Clubs from Ibadan to Benin City and Aba to Ikenne have once again drawn the battle lines as they pursue two very different ambitions. While some teams are pushing for coveted Super Six qualification, others are fighting desperately to stay afloat in the top flight.

With the first stanza completed, the pressure has intensified across both groups. While teams in the relegation zone must immediately begin their recovery, title contenders aim to solidify their positions.

Here is a detailed look at the Matchday 10 fixtures and what to expect from each encounter.

Pacesetters Queens vs Adamawa Queens

In Ibadan, Pacesetters Queens face one of their most important matches of the season. The Oluyole-based side endured a miserable first stanza, collecting just one point from eight matches. They remain the only team in the league yet to record a victory this season.

If they are to keep their Premiership survival hopes alive, their revival must begin immediately. Standing in their way are Adamawa Queens, one of the most in-form sides in the league this season.

Adamawa Queens currently sit fourth on the table with 13 points and will arrive in Ibadan confident of securing another positive result on the road. The reverse fixture in Makurdi ended in a comfortable 2–0 win for Adamawa Queens, with Ifeoma Damian and Mary Sunday scoring second-half goals.

For Pacesetters Queens, anything less than a victory could push their season closer to collapse.

Ekiti Queens vs Heartland Queens

Ekiti Queens will play their final home match in Abeokuta after temporarily relocating due to stadium issues. The BAO Ladies will be eager to bid farewell to the venue with a victory that could boost their survival hopes.

Their time in Abeokuta has produced mixed results, with one win and one defeat. They currently sit sixth on the table with seven points.

Heartland Queens arrive with a positive mindset, having achieved one of the season’s biggest results. The Owerri side ended the unbeaten run of defending champions Bayelsa Queens with a stunning 3–1 victory in their final first-stanza match.

With 11 points and sitting fifth on the table, Heartland Queens will be looking to continue their upward momentum.

The reverse fixture was equally dramatic. Ekiti Queens took the lead through Amarachi Okoronkwo, who scored the fastest goal of the season in the third minute. However, Heartland Queens fought back through Chizoba Johnson and Emanuella James to claim a 2–1 victory.

Ibom Angels vs Naija Ratels

Ibom Angels have endured a difficult campaign so far. With just two wins, one draw, and five defeats, the Uyo-based club finds itself dangerously close to the relegation zone.

They will be hoping to turn their fortunes around as they begin the second stanza at home.

Their opponents, the Naija Ratels, have also struggled this season. The Abuja side sits eighth on the table with five points from eight matches, making this encounter a crucial survival battle for both teams.

When the two teams met earlier in the season, the match ended in a goalless draw. Both sides will now be desperate to secure the three points that could provide momentum for the remainder of the campaign.

Edo Queens vs Bayelsa Queens

One of the most anticipated fixtures of the round will take place in Benin City as former champions Edo Queens host defending champions Bayelsa Queens.

Their first meeting earlier this season delivered drama, controversy, and goals, making it one of the standout matches of the opening round.

Heartland Queens shocked Bayelsa Queens in the final match of the first stanza, ending their impressive unbeaten run. The Prosperity Girls’ loss shows they’re not invincible, and their rivals will be ready to pounce.

Bayelsa Queens currently lead Group A with 21 points, while Edo Queens remain one of the strongest challengers in the group.

Beyond the points, there is also an added storyline. Edo Queens’ head coach previously worked with Bayelsa Queens, adding another layer of intrigue to the clash.

With Super Six qualification approaching, both teams will want to assert dominance early in the second stanza.

Abia Angels vs Confluence Queens

Abia Angels have quietly enjoyed an impressive campaign so far. With 17 points from nine matches, they have positioned themselves as serious contenders for a Super Six ticket.

They now welcome Confluence Queens to Aba in what could be another opportunity to strengthen their standing.

Confluence Queens have struggled this season, managing just six points from nine matches. Their defensive struggles have been particularly worrying, having conceded 18 goals while scoring only eight.

The first meeting between the two teams ended in a thrilling 2–2 draw. Confluence Queens felt aggrieved by the officiating in that encounter, believing they were denied a potential victory.

Akosile Mary and Blessing Sunday scored for Confluence Queens in that match, while Funmilayo Adefuye and Blessing Okon found the net for Abia Angels.

FC Robo Queens vs Sunshine Queens

FC Robo Queens began the season strongly and remain one of the most consistent teams in Group B. They currently lead the group with 21 points despite suffering defeats in two matches before the break.

The Lagos-based club defeated Sunshine Queens 1–0 in their first meeting in Akure thanks to a goal from Marvellous Oladunni.

However, Sunshine Queens have improved significantly since that loss. The Akure side responded with strong performances, winning important home matches and securing valuable away points to finish the first stanza with 11 points in fifth place.

With both teams showing strong form recently, this rematch promises to be highly competitive.

Remo Stars Ladies vs Ahudiyannem Queens

Remo Stars Ladies began the season slowly but gradually found their rhythm as the first stanza progressed. They eventually climbed to second place in Group B with 18 points.

Their opponents, Ahudiyannem Queens, are experiencing the harsh realities of life in the top flight, struggling to adapt to the competitive nature of the league and facing challenges such as injuries and lack of experience. The debutants currently sit at the bottom of the table with five points from nine matches.

Although the first meeting between both sides ended in a goalless draw, Remo Stars Ladies will be determined to secure a victory this time, especially in front of their home supporters in Ikenne.

Delta Queens vs Nasarawa Amazons

Delta Queens have been one of the most unpredictable teams this season. Despite being former champions, their performances have fluctuated throughout the campaign.

Even a change in coaching staff has not significantly improved their results. With 11 points from nine matches, their position remains uncertain.

They now face a major test against Nasarawa Amazons, who currently occupy third place with 18 points.

When the two sides met earlier in the season, Delta Queens took the lead through Nora Davies but eventually lost 2–1. Olushola Shobowale and Hembafan Ayatsea scored the comeback goals for the Nasarawa Amazons.

Delta Queens will need a strong performance if they hope to revive their Super Six ambitions.

Osun Babes vs Dannaz Ladies

The Southwest derby in Ile Ogbo could prove decisive in the relegation battle.

Osun Babes sit seventh on the table with nine points, while Dannaz Ladies are just behind them in eighth place with seven points. Both teams understand that dropping points in this fixture could have serious consequences.

Dannaz Ladies have struggled defensively this season, conceding 20 goals in nine matches, which is the worst defensive record in the league.

Their first meeting was one of the most entertaining games of the season. A late goal gave Dannaz Ladies a thrilling 3–2 victory. Fatima Sholaty, Korie Ulumma, and Ajoke Akinbo scored for Dannaz Ladies, while Sharon Shomuyiwa and Robiat Taofeeq found the net for Osun Babes.

With survival at stake, another intense encounter is expected.

A Pivotal Matchday for the NWFL Premiership

As the second stanza begins, every point becomes more valuable. Teams chasing the Super Six will want to create early momentum, while those battling relegation must fight for survival with renewed urgency.

Matchday 10 promises drama, intensity, and defining moments across the country as the Nigeria Women Football League Premiership enters a decisive phase of the season.
